Ticket: SDK parity drift between Fernwick-JS and Fernwick-Go

Welcome aboard! Quick context: the two client SDKs are supposed to read identical defaults, but the Go client drifted after last quarter's refactor — retry counts and timeout handling no longer match. First task is reconciling them. To save you digging, the canonical values the JS client currently ships with are below.

settings of yahip-yagug:
[fraath]
host = fraath.ferragrid.corp
user = fraath_svc
database = fraath_prod

# Support Outsourcing Plan — Managers Only

This page summarises the plan to transfer tier-one customer support to Calveron Response Services starting next quarter. Branch managers should note that local support desks will remain open during the six-week transition, after which routine tickets route to Calveron's Westmere centre. Escalations stay in-house. Staffing impacts vary by branch; redeployment options are being finalised. Questions go through your regional lead. The confidential note on related business plans appears directly below.

board note of bawep-tajef: Queniusek Systems plans to raise the Quenvan list price by 53.1 percent in March. The pricing group signed off on a budget of $176.4 million for Project Drueth. The renewal with Casionix Partners closes at $142.5 million a year, 8.3 percent below the last contract. Project Fraax slips by six weeks because of the tooling delay.

## Alert: Brimvale Metrics Sidecar Backpressure

This alert fires when the Brimvale aggregation sidecar's flush queue exceeds 10,000 pending batches for more than five minutes. It usually indicates the downstream rollup service is slow or the sidecar's memory ceiling was lowered during deploy. Check the sidecar's flush latency histogram before restarting; a restart drops unflushed batches permanently. If the rollup service looks healthy, the issue is likely local, and you should loop in the telemetry owners.

escalation mailbox, bafog-fafog: ulador@paliqlabs.internal

Handover: profile-store sharding (Velmora)

Hey — quick brain dump before I'm out. We're mid-flight splitting the Velmora user-profile store into 16 shards, keyed on account hash. Plugin authors: your reads go through the Tidegate router now, so don't hardcode shard names. Rebalance jobs run weekends; expect brief read-only windows. The migration tracker lives in the Plumwick wiki. If anything looks off with shard routing, ping the new owner listed below.

named custodian: Brivan Eliath Quenox Frador